How many of the Vibe parts can be used on the Vigor?

Are you talking about the CS or Standard? If your talking about the CS a lot of the vibe parts are the same and other will fit without doing anything and like the clutch you will need to get the complete assembly clutch, clutch bell, starter shaft and hex adapter (witch is a lot better) you can even put a vibe canopy on it very easily if you wanted to

but a good upgrade for the vigor CS is get the Bevel gear hub for the vibe and the clutch assembly if your going with a 90 motor

just the clutch and bevel gear hub the vibe gear hub has support for the bevel gear where the vigor didn't and the clutch has a bigger oneway bearing to handle the 90 better

vibe head and swash are better for the 3D stuff before i buy a vibe head i'll get a FBL system but the stock vigor CS it's a sold machine

I have a CS and have done alot of work to it and made it into a contest machine. It is very smooth and steady and really can be made to be a contest type machine or a full 3D machine.

I did update the clutch on mine but more because I had a hot start and needed to re do the lining anyway. I originally ran a CSpec in it but now am currently running an HZ in it. To do the clutch upgrade you need the clutch, the start shaft, the hex coupler, and a couple of bearings that need to be replaced because of the larger start shaft size. The bevel gear on the CS is the same as the Vibe (unless you are refering to something other than what I am thinking).

Really I don't think you really need to update anything on the CS. Just go and fly it if it is ready to go. 99 percent of the upgrades I did were solely based on what I wanted out of it as a contest machine.
